The pandemic has redefined priorities and assigned a new value to living space. It is no coincidence that the national real estate sector has undergone a reconfiguration, not so much in terms of prices, but in terms of preferences in purchasing choices.
In particular, while the cities by the sea have suffered a decline, the demand for houses by the lake is increasing, as are their prices.To make the pricing situation even more favorable is the general improvement in conditions linked to the pandemic, which has fostered a climate of greater optimism, with the desire to return to investing and seeking better housing solutions.

A recent New York Times article highlighted an interesting real estate trend: international buyers prefer buying a house on the lake in Italy. But that's not all: overseas investors show that they prefer the locations around Lago Maggiore to those near other more luxurious and popular Lombard lakes.
In general, the reason lies in a greater attention to factors such as price, but also in the search for places where life is more sustainable and peaceful. Two other features that make houses for sale Lake Maggiore more attractive to buyers, especially foreigners (mostly from Germany, Switzerland, Great Britain and the United States), are the large spaces and greater privacy compared to other localities that are more touristy and fashionable.
Last but not least, there is the undeniable charm of a perfect place for a getaway out of town all year round, where you can enjoy the coolness of the lake in summer and the beauties of the mountains in winter.
All in all, the Italian real estate market has withstood the pandemic well. Although the rental sector suffered a setback, albeit with some exceptions, the sales sector was less affected by the crisis. Prices of houses for sale across the country increased 2.6% in 2020 from the previous year.
One of the data that stands out most from the most recent statistics attests that, while the larger cities such as Milan and Rome seem not to have been affected by the Covid effect, the seaside cities have recorded a slight drop in prices (-0.5%) , all to the advantage of mountain destinations and the great Italian lakes which recorded an increase (+ 0.3%).
What are the types of properties preferred by those who aim to buy a house by the lake? Definitely two-room and three-room apartments with lake view, perfect as an investment for buyers from Lombardy and Piedmont looking for a holiday home.
The demand for independent apartments and houses on the lake and in good condition, to be purchased as a first home and ready to live in, is also increasing. For a year now, the most sought-after solutions with garden, terrace or large outdoor spaces have been confirmed. On the other hand, it is mainly the luxury lake view properties that attract foreign investors, especially those of great artistic value and equipped with the latest generation systems, able to ensure comfort and tranquility.
